For more than 25 years, Catherine’s Health Center has provided access to high quality, affordable, and compassionate health care for the underserved throughout West Michigan. As a Federally Qualified Health Center (FQHC), Catherine’s offers the opportunity to work with a team that engages patients as active partners in their care in a warm, friendly, safe, and modern atmosphere. Catherine’s provides primary medical care, dental care, behavioral health care, and health support services across three locations in West Michigan, with rapidly growing plans to expand to new locations and services to meet the needs of the community.

Job Summary
The Front Office Receptionist will work with a lively team to ensure an efficient and positive experience for patients. Responsibilities will include greeting patients, patient registration, answering phones, scheduling appointments, patient check out, insurance verification and records processing.
